And the Colonels continue on...

The 2008 Curry Football team won its first game of the NCAA Tournament this past Saturday. The number seven-seeded Colonels upset the heavily favored number two-seeded Ithaca College Bombers in the regional quarterfinals. The Colonels move on to the regional semifinals where they will meet Cortland St. next Saturday, Nov 29th. A full recap of the game can be found here.

ONE Curry... is number one!

Following a feature article in the Boston Globe this summer, ONE Curry continues to be recognized both in our home state and throughout the country! ONE Curry is a student-run organization that seeks to raise awareness on the issues of extreme poverty, AIDS, and other human injustices. This week, the National ONE Campaign awarded ONE Curry as its weekly challenge winner! Read all about the ONE Campus Challenge and Curry's success here.

Catch the Colonels!

With the Fall academic semester approaching fast, I am reminded that the Fall athletic season will also begin shortly. During the Fall season, Curry competes in men's football and soccer, and women's cross country, soccer, and tennis. A complete Fall athletic schedule can be found here. The annual Purple & White football scrimmage will be held at 2:30 on August 23rd, with the opening home game of the 2008 season to be held on September 13th. The football team is coming off its fifth consecutive NEFC Championship and made its fifth-straight appearance in the NCAA Division III tournament. Summer Writing?

As we head into the middle of summer and indulge in the time-honored tradition of summer reading, let me propose another useful activity: summer writing. Before you begin your busy senior year, take some time to get a head start on your college applications. And, as a special treat to my dedicated readers here at the Curry College Admission Blog, I'm going to reveal the essay questions found on the Curry College Application. Our application asks you to choose from one of the following questions:

1. Describe your most significant success, failure, or personal experience to date. How has it affected your life?
2. Choose an issue of international, local, or national concern that is of special interest to you. Describe your position on the issue and how you would resolve it.
3. Tell us of a person who has had a significant influence on your life and describe the way in which this person has affected you.

So remember to bring some paper and a pencil along with your clunky copy of The Grapes of Wrath to the beach this summer. Happy writing!

Chloe and the Colonel meet at Curry College!

Today Curry welcomed the crew from YOUniversity TV to campus. This Florida based company provides prospective students with online video tours of college campuses. They made the trip to Milton as part of their national tour. Curry was their first stop in Massachusetts and will be featured on their website soon! We enjoyed taking the hosts, Chloe and Lavaughn, around on this unusually cold May day. Highlights included meeting the Curry Colonel, playing football on the Walter M. Katz Field, and sitting behind the news desk of Curry Channel 8. Did you know that Curry College is one the first colleges in the country to offer HDTV instruction? This is one of the many cool facts that was covered during the tour. So check back in the coming months for a link to the video!
